QCM20Q.inf Driver File Contents (R277344.exe)

; Copyright (c) Quanta Computer Inc.  All rights reserved.

[Version]
Signature="$CHICAGO$"
Class=Image
ClassGUID={6bdd1fc6-810f-11d0-bec7-08002be2092f}
Provider=%CompanyName%
CatalogFile=QCM20Q.cat
DriverVer=05/14/2010,1.0.1404.1005

[SourceDisksNames]
1=%Package%

[SourceDisksFiles]
qicflt.sys=1

[ControlFlags]
ExcludeFromSelect=*

[DestinationDirs]
PID_1020.CopyList=10,system32\drivers    ; %systemroot%\system32\drivers on NT-based systems

[Manufacturer]
%CompanyName%=QCV,nt,ntamd64

[QCV]
;0408 is Quanta
%PID_20Q1.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B7&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B8&MI_00

[QCV.NT]
; xp later version
;0408 is Quanta
%PID_20Q1.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B7&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B8&MI_00

[QCV.NTamd64]
; xp later version 64 bit O.S.
;0408 is Quanta
%PID_20Q1.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_2F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B1&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B2&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B3&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B4&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B5&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B6&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B7&MI_00
%PID_20Q2.DeviceDesc%=PID_1020,USB\Vid_0408&Pid_1FB8&MI_00

;------------------QCV 1020 
[PID_1020.NT]
Include=usbvideo.inf, ks.inf, kscaptur.inf, dshowext.inf
Needs=Composite.Dev.NT,USBVideo.NT, KS.Registration, KSCAPTUR.Registration.NT, DSHOWEXT.Registration
AddReg=PID_1020.AddReg
CopyFiles=PID_1020.CopyList

[PID_1020.NTamd64]
Include=usbvideo.inf, ks.inf, kscaptur.inf, dshowext.inf
Needs=Composite.Dev.NT,USBVideo.NT, KS.Registration, KSCAPTUR.Registration.NT, DSHOWEXT.Registration
AddReg=PID_1020.AddReg
CopyFiles=PID_1020.CopyList

[PID_1020.AddReg]

;;;;;;;;;;;;;;;;;;;;;;comment it out
;[PID_1020.Interfaces]
;AddInterface=%KSCATEGORY_CAPTURE%,GLOBAL,PID_1020.Interface
;AddInterface=%KSCATEGORY_RENDER%,GLOBAL,PID_1020.Interface
;AddInterface=%KSCATEGORY_VIDEO%,GLOBAL,PID_1020.Interface
;AddInterface=%KSCATEGORY_RENDER_EXT%,GLOBAL,PID_1020.Interface

[PID_1020.NT.Interfaces]
AddInterface=%KSCATEGORY_CAPTURE%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_RENDER%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_VIDEO%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_RENDER_EXT%,GLOBAL,PID_1020.Interface


[PID_1020.NTamd64.Interfaces]
AddInterface=%KSCATEGORY_CAPTURE%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_RENDER%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_VIDEO%,GLOBAL,PID_1020.Interface
AddInterface=%KSCATEGORY_RENDER_EXT%,GLOBAL,PID_1020.Interface


[PID_1020.Interface]
AddReg=PID_1020.Interface.AddReg

[PID_1020.Interface.AddReg]
HKR,,CLSID,,%ProxyVCap.CLSID%
HKR,,FriendlyName,,%PID_0408.FriendDeviceDesc%
HKR,,RTCFlags,0x00010001,0x00000010

[PID_1020.NT.Services]
Needs=Composite.Dev.NT.Services
DelService = qicupper,0x00000200
DelService = qicflt,0x00000200
AddService = usbvideo,0x00000002,PID_1020.ServiceInstall
AddService = qicflt,, PID_1020.NT.Devupper_Service_Inst

[PID_1020.NTamd64.Services]
Needs=Composite.Dev.NT.Services
DelService = qicupper,0x00000200
DelService = qicflt,0x00000200
AddService = usbvideo,0x00000002,PID_1020.ServiceInstall
AddService = qicflt,, PID_1020.NT.Devupper_Service_Inst

[PID_1020.ServiceInstall]
DisplayName   = %USBVideo.SvcDesc%
ServiceType   = %SERVICE_KERNEL_DRIVER%
StartType     = %SERVICE_DEMAND_START%
ErrorControl  = %SERVICE_ERROR_NORMAL%
ServiceBinary = %10%\System32\Drivers\usbvideo.sys

[PID_1020.CopyList]
qicflt.sys
;devlower.sys

[PID_1020.NT.HW]
DelReg=PID_1020.NT.HW.DelReg
AddReg=PID_1020.NT.HW.AddReg

[PID_1020.NTamd64.HW]
DelReg=PID_1020.NT.HW.DelReg
AddReg=PID_1020.NT.HW.AddReg


[PID_1020.NT.HW.DelReg]
HKR,,"UpperFilters"

[PID_1020.NT.HW.AddReg]
HKR,,"UpperFilters",0x00010000,"qicflt"


[PID_1020.NT.Devupper_Service_Inst]
DisplayName    = %upperfilter.SvcDesc% 
ServiceType    = 1               ; SERVICE_KERNEL_DRIVER
StartType      = 3               ; SERVICE_DEMAND_START 
ErrorControl   = 1               ; SERVICE_ERROR_NORMAL
ServiceBinary  = %12%\qicflt.sys
LoadOrderGroup = PNP Filter

[DefaultUninstall]
DelFiles = PID_1020.CopyList

[DefaultUninstall.Services]
DelService = qicflt,0x00000200 ; SPSVCINST_STOPSERVICE


[Strings]
; Non-localizable
ProxyVCap.CLSID="{17CCA71B-ECD7-11D0-B908-00A0C9223196}"
KSCATEGORY_RENDER="{65E8773E-8F56-11D0-A3B9-00A0C9223196}"
KSCATEGORY_CAPTURE="{65E8773D-8F56-11D0-A3B9-00A0C9223196}"
KSCATEGORY_VIDEO="{6994AD05-93EF-11D0-A3CC-00A0C9223196}"
KSCATEGORY_RENDER_EXT="{CC7BFB41-F175-11D1-A392-00E0291F3959}"
SERVICE_KERNEL_DRIVER=1
SERVICE_DEMAND_START=3
SERVICE_ERROR_NORMAL=1

; Localizable
CompanyName="Quanta Computer Inc."
Package="Quanta Installation Package"
PID_20Q1.DeviceDesc="Integrated Webcam"
PID_20Q2.DeviceDesc="Integrated Webcam"
USBVideo.SvcDesc="USB Video Device (WDM)"
upperfilter.SvcDesc = "upper Device Filter Driver"
lowerfilter.SvcDesc = "lower Device Filter Driver"
PID_0408.FriendDeviceDesc = "Integrated Webcam"
Download Driver Pack

How To Update Drivers Manually

After your driver has been downloaded, follow these simple steps to install it.

  • Expand the archive file (if the download file is in zip or rar format).

  • If the expanded file has an .exe extension, double click it and follow the installation instructions.

  • Otherwise, open Device Manager by right-clicking the Start menu and selecting Device Manager.

  • Find the device and model you want to update in the device list.

  • Double-click on it to open the Properties dialog box.

  • From the Properties dialog box, select the Driver tab.

  • Click the Update Driver button, then follow the instructions.

Very important: You must reboot your system to ensure that any driver updates have taken effect.

For more help, visit our Driver Support section for step-by-step videos on how to install drivers for every file type.

server: web3, load: 1.76